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Trap material and durability: Weather-resistant plastic extends lifespan in outdoor apiaries. Look for UV-stable or fade-proof finishes to prevent material degradation.
  • Trap design: Double-compartment or single-chamber designs affect capture efficiency and maintenance. Consider ease of removing and cleaning the traps between checks.
  • Attractants and compatibility: Some traps perform best with mineral oil, vegetable oil, crushed fruit, or lime. Verify compatibility with your preferred attractants and management routine.
  • Size and fleet needs: For large apiaries, bulk packs (50–100+ traps) minimize downtime and ensure continuous coverage. For hobby setups, smaller packs may suffice.
  • Aesthetic and hive integration: Black, white, or clear traps can blend with hive boxes. Choose a color and style that minimizes disturbance to bees while remaining visible enough for monitoring.
  • Reusability and hygiene: Reusable traps save long-term costs but require thorough cleaning to prevent residue buildup. Ensure traps are easy to disinfect.
  • Non-toxicity: Pesticide-free options are preferred for hobbyists and professionals aiming to avoid chemical exposure to bees and honey.
  • Installation ease: Look for designs that insert between frames or sit securely without interfering with colony movement.
